Scouts help deployed troops have better holiday season

SEYMOUR JOHNSON AIR FORCE BASE, N.C. -- Master Sgt. Brian Sterling, a reservist with the 916th Maintenance Squadron, sits with his son Jacob, age 8, as they display the items collected by Jacob's Boy Scout Troop, Pack 922 out of Walkertown, N.C. Jacob's wolf den decided they wanted to help out troops overseas during the holiday and collected items ranging from electric blankets to hot chocolate mix. The young scouts collected items over a three week period and then went on AnyAirman.com to find some deployed troops from Seymour Johnson that they could support.
